Title: The Innovative Contributions of Stephen Z Baxter

Introduction

Stephen Z Baxter is a notable inventor based in Dallas, NC (US). He has made significant contributions to the field of concrete technology, holding a total of 3 patents. His work focuses on enhancing concrete compositions through the incorporation of recycled materials and innovative methods.

Latest Patents

Baxter's latest patents include a concrete composition that contains glass, including ordinary recycled glass. This invention also relates to methods of producing these concrete compositions. Additionally, he has developed a concrete composition that incorporates glass particles, including recycled glass, along with substances to mitigate alkali-silica reactions, such as E-glass particles and pozzolans. Another significant patent involves cements that include lithium glass compositions, which are capable of minimizing the effects of alkali-silica reactions in concrete. This lithium glass comprises a glass-forming oxide, lithium oxide, and is optionally free of sodium or potassium ions.
